Transaction 3014c12b379cdad23960e93f8ad1b95053fa71ddeec21a9929f804993e6116f4
1 Input
1 Output
-
3014c12b379cdad23960e93f8ad1b95053fa71ddeec21a9929f804993e6116f4:0
- value
- 6586138
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5c63038f68e497e36e2e918c082909c2079de759 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19RVnFoiJbFZF16FG2Nbc5Fn7Fe7ERKpus